▷ Due to the large variety of USB devices avail‐
able on the market, operation via the vehicle
cannot be ensured for every charger. The
charging time depends on the charger used.
▷ During charging, the charger and display key
can heat up. At higher temperatures, a reduc‐
tion in the charging current can occur due to
the display key; in exceptional cases, the
charging process is temporarily interrupted.
Charging
Via USB
Connect the display key to a USB port using the
micro-USB charging connection.
In the wireless charging dock
1.
Open the cover of the dock.
2. Place the display key in the middle of the
wireless charging dock in front of the cu‐
pholders.
Make sure that the display is pointing up‐
wards.
3. Close the cover of the dock.
Malfunction
General
A Check Control message is shown.
Detection of the BMW display key by the vehicle
may be disrupted by the following circumstan‐
ces, amongst others:
▷ The battery of the display key is flat. Re‐
charging the battery, see page 80.
▷ Disruption of the radio link by transmission
masts or other equipment transmitting pow‐
erful signals.
▷ Shielding of the display key by metallic ob‐
jects.
▷ Disruption of the radio link by mobile tele‐
phones or other electronic devices in the im‐
mediate vicinity.
▷ Interference with the radio link caused by the
charging of mobile devices, for example a
mobile phone.
Do not transport the display key together with
metallic objects or electronic devices.
If there is a malfunction, the vehicle can be un‐
locked and locked from the outside with the me‐
chanical key.
Switching on drive-ready state by
special ID of the BMW display key
The drive-ready state cannot be switched on if
the display key has not been detected.
If this happens, proceed as follows:
1.
Hold the back of the display key against the
mark on the steering column. Pay attention to
the display in the instrument cluster.
2. If the display key is detected:
Switch on drive-ready state within 10 sec‐
onds.
If the display key is not detected, change the po‐
sition of the display key slightly and repeat the
procedure.
